How does insPIRE help today's Golfer?
There are over 26 million golfers in the US today. Lower back pain accounts for 50% of all golf-related complaints. For Pro golfers, lower back pain accounts for about 80% of their physical complaints. This indicates that their is an inherent, sports-related cause for these injuries.

Most injuries are overuse-related due to Deconditioned Muscles, Lack of Flexibility, Poor Swing Mechanics, General fatigue, and Excessive Practice (you can’t change a Winter of deconditioning in 100 swings at the driving range the day before a match - yet how common is this???)

The Primary Sport-Specific Factors is the Massive Torque Production in low back and hips during the golf swing, as well as General fatigue, which results in poor mechanics and compensatory changes leading to increased stress on the skeletal system.
